Job Title or Location
RECENT SEARCHES

Senior Software Engineer | IT Software Development

Knewin
Toronto, ON
Executive
Posted 12 days ago

We believe small businesses are at the heart of our communities, and championing them is worth fighting for. We empower small business owners to manage their finances fearlessly, by offering the simplest, all-in-one financial management solution they can't live without. About the Engineering Team: At Wave, you won't just write code—you'll build high-quality systems at scale. This means being involved in the research, design, and organizational and maintenance practices behind our wide range of applications, which are relied upon by tens of thousands of small business owners. Most Wave engineers are willing and able to dive into different technologies to get the job done. This requires curiosity, openness to new ideas and perspectives, and a genuine interest in what makes software products tick. As a Software Engineer in the Front-end domain, you will join one of the many cross-functional engineering teams to work alongside Product, Design and other developers to build software to solve exciting business challenges. You will bring your front-end skills to bear on making our React and ReactNative apps scale better and stay ahead of these quickly evolving ecosystem, helping the teams around also contribute better code by laying good React/ReactNative standards and building solid interfaces and reusable utilities and libraries that make everyone's lives better. You will be exposed to a wide variety of technologies and help investigate new ones as we are constantly striving to keep our technology choices up to date. As an engineering team, we deeply care about being the best in our craft - Performance, Reliability, Reusability, Code Quality, Test Coverage, and Observability. You will help maintain the current bar we have but will hopefully go on to raise it to the next level. Our web/mobile toolkit where you'll be working is primarily React and ReactNative with Typescript and Javascript. Our APIs are GraphQL and REST powered by services written in Python and Django, as well as Rails and Golang. We expect software developers working on the front-end to have enough familiarity with API development to be able to collaborate with back-end developers to devise solutions to product challenges, and to contribute to code on the API layer when needed. We Are a Community: Wave is about the size of a small neighbourhood. If you're trying to solve a hard problem that has roots in some other part of the company, odds are pretty good that you'll find someone close by who can help you out. However, if you're ready to flex your creativity, excel at your craft, fuel your curiosity, and thrive in a dynamic environment, we're confident you'll love being a Waver. Work From Where You Work Best: We will always have a welcoming, energizing, and world-class office (in Toronto) with a space for you. Or, if you're more comfortable working from home, the choice is yours . We Care About Future You: You will stretch yourself and you will grow at Wave. Fair compensation, all the office perks you'd want, and the various goodies you'd expect from a growing tech company. Work From Where You Work Best: We will always have a welcoming, energizing, and world-class office (in Toronto) with a space for you. Or, if you're more comfortable working from home, the choice is yours . Fair compensation, all the office perks you'd want, and the various goodies you'd expect from a growing tech company. We've been continuously recognized as one of Canada's Top Ten Most Admired Corporate Cultures and one of Canada's Great Places to Work in categories including Technology, Millennials, Mental Health, Inclusion and Women.